Etymology

edit

From Latin pecora, neuter plural of pecus (cattle), from pecū, from Proto-Indo-European *peḱu- (livestock, domestic animals).

Noun

edit

pêgoa f (plural pêgoe, diminutive pêgoêta)

  1. (zoology) sheep
